Travelers Share Their Road Trip Experience During School Holidays in Europe

2023-07-08 07:34:00

We expect a lot of people on the roads today in the direction of departures. We met a few vacationers who got behind the wheel early this morning. Cornelius thus goes to the Morvan for the holidays where he intends to stay for three weeks. “I know the road well. Today it’s very calm,” he told us. For his part Romain hopes to arrive at the end of the day in the south-west of France. “We have a 10-hour drive, we take short breaks every hour. We have a little coffee, something to eat and we sit in the sun for a bit”, says the young man.

Note that this weekend is synonymous with the first weekend of school holidays in French-speaking Belgium as in France. Touring therefore foresees difficult traffic in Europe with some slowdowns (orange color code), or even very difficult locally (red code) in the direction of the south.
